Our mandate is

  • To ensure equal access and opportunity for immigrants and refugees and to facilitate their integration into Canadian society on the basis of available resources and within the context of the Association's mandate.
  • To provide services to heritage groups in order to assist them in both retaining their own culture and in sharing it with others.
  • To promote multiculturalism in the community by heightening public awareness of the benefits of and the necessity for cross cultural understanding by developing and instituting programs to promote such understanding, thus enriching Canadian society.
